A tool designed for predicting or estimating completion times for an Ironman triathlon, based on user-provided information such as anticipated swim, bike, and run paces, as well as transition times, helps athletes set realistic goals and develop effective training plans. For instance, inputting a target swim pace and estimated transition durations allows athletes to project their overall race completion time.
Accurate race time prediction offers several advantages for athletes engaging in these demanding events. Precise estimations facilitate the development of tailored training strategies, aid in effective pacing during the race itself, and provide a valuable benchmark for evaluating progress. Moreover, such tools can motivate athletes by providing a tangible target, fostering a sense of preparedness and confidence.
